Cameroon coach Clarence Seedorf has expressed his satisfaction with his side’s 0-0 stalemate against Ghana on Saturday.

“We possessed the ball well most of the time and all the players did well. A win was our goal but a draw is a good result” the Dutch manager told reporters after the match”

The vital point meant the Indomitable Lions have a foot in the next stage ahead of their final Group F game against Benin on Tuesday.

The defending champions are top of the Group with 4 points after the opening two games.
